Basic Buttery Biscuits

Ingredients

  • 2 1/4 cup all purpose baking mix
  • 1/3 cup buttermilk
  • 6 T. unsalted butter, melted and divided.

Details

Servings 24

Preparation

Step 1

Stir together baking mix, buttermilk, and 5 T. melted butter until just blended.

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face, and knead 1 to 2 times. Pat to a 1/2" thickness; cut with a 1 1/2" round cutter, and place on lightly greased baking sheets.

Bake at 450 degrees for 7 to 9 minutes or until lightly browned. Brush tops with remaining 1 tablespoon melted butter.

Note-For testing purposes only we used Bisquick all purpose baking mix.

To make ahead: Freeze unbaked biscuits on a lightly greased baking sheet 30 minutes or until frozen. Store in a zip-top plastic freezer bag for up to 3 months. Bake as directed for 8-10 minutes.

Cranberry-Orange Glazed Biscuits: Decrease baking mix to 2 cups plus 2 tablespoons. Add 1/2 cup chopped dried cranberries to baking mix. Prepare dough, and bake as directed. Omit 1 tablespoon butter for brushing biscuits after baking. Stir together 6 tablespoons powdered sugar, 1 tablespoon orange juice and 1/4 teaspoon grated orange rind. Drizzle evenly over warm biscuits.
